Errors
54 ZTMF-ERR-INVALIDLABELMEDIA
The specified LABEL attribute is invalid or not present.
55 ZTMF-ERR-INVALIDUNLOADMEDIA
The specified UNLOAD attribute is invalid.
56 ZTMF-ERR-INVALIDMATSNFATSN
One (or both) audit-trail sequence number(s) is/are invalid.
57 ZTMF-ERR-NOMATSNFATSN
An audit-trail sequence number must be specified with this command.
58 ZTMF-ERR-FILENAMEWILD
A filename cannot be specified with the wildcard (*) syntax (within this context).
The ZTMF-TKN-FILENAME token supplied within the error list provides
additional information.
59 ZTMF-ERR-MEDIAREQUIRED
At least one tape volume must be specified with this command.
60 ZTMF-ERR-INVALIDDUMPINVALID
The specified INVALID attribute is invalid.
61 ZTMF-ERR-INVALIDMAXRESP
The specified MAXRESP value is invalid. The specified value must be greater
than or equal to -1.
63 ZTMF-ERR-INVALIDMEDIUMTYPE
The specified MEDIUM attribute is invalid. Either TAPE or DISK must be
specified.
64 ZTMF-ERR-INVALIDSYSTEMNAME
The specified SYSTEM name is invalid.
66 ZTMF-ERR-INVALIDOVERWRITELABEL
The value specified for the OVERWRITELABEL attribute is invalid. TRUE,
FALSE, or NULL must be specified.
